Pediatric Endocrinologist Division Chief
4 months ago
The Medical University of South Carolina (MUSC) Department of Pediatrics seeks a Pediatric Endocrinologist at the Associate Professor or Professor level to serve as the Division Chief to the Division of Pediatric Endocrinology. Currently the Division includes five faculty members, one advanced practice provider and many other support staff including social workers and dieticians.
This opportunity is located in Charleston, SC at a major academic medical center that serves a diverse population of patients from a large geographic area.
Ranked among the top programs in the country, the Division of Pediatric Endocrinology and Diabetes operates within MUSCs Department of Pediatrics and provides comprehensive diagnostic and treatment services for a broad range of diagnoses. Division members currently include 2 full time in person M.D. Faculty members, 2 full time Tele-MDs, 2 part time Tele-MDs, 1 in person APP, a dietician, and a dedicated social worker. The Division provides comprehensive care to children and teenagers with diabetes and a variety of other endocrine issues. We conduct clinical research studies that offer patients and their families an opportunity to participate in population health research as well as clinical trials.
